Women’s stories have been erased for millennia and this crisis of disappearance is still happening today. In 2017, the National Women’s History Museum released a report titled “ Where Are the Women?” on the status of women in state social studies standards and IT. WAS. BLEAK. The report found that 178 women are named in state standards, in stark contrast with the 559 male historical figures. That’s a 1 to 3 ratio—worse than the tech company holiday party Kylie went to that time she dated a UX developer. In case you’re not pissed yet, of those 178 women, 63% are white and there's not ONE Asian American woman listed.
